Benefit Dinner for Craig Family
12/10/2012 (Updated 12/11/2012 12:00:36 AM)
A chicken and bisquit dinner was held with proceeds going to help offset medical and transportation expenses for the Craig family.
One of their two sons, Matthew, passed away recently after a struggle with a congenital heart disorder.
Now, Matthew's mother is battling cancer.
Friends and neigbhors are extending their hearts and concerns:
"We come from a very very good community, we've had an out pouring of help and as I stated earlier, we started with 1200 biscuits and we just ran out. That means that we've gone through 600 meals so we're making potatoes now and we've still got plenty of food so it's been a great turn out," said Jim Tokos, head organizer for the dinner
Matthew Craig and his brother attended Maine-Endwell schools.
